Lazada Philippines to boost AI features for sellers and buyers

ELECTRONIC commerce platform Lazada Philippines is set to integrate more artificial intelligence (AI) features to streamline seller workflows and increase buyer traffic.
"We've been working on certain work streams to integrate AI. Today, there are more than 12 separate work streams where we are looking at the value of AI and the ways to support it," Lazada Philippines Chief Executive Officer Carlos Barrera said in an interview with Business World.
The platform aims to use AI to enhance its content and catalogue offerings, he said.
